Mold growth on washing machine rubber seals, including the door gasket and bellow, is a common problem. This unsightly and potentially unhygienic issue arises from trapped moisture, detergent residue, and lint, creating a breeding ground for mold spores. Effective removal requires targeted cleaning methods to eliminate the mold and prevent its recurrence.

Maintaining a mold-free washing machine is essential for hygiene and appliance longevity. Mold can cause unpleasant odors, transfer stains to laundry, and potentially trigger allergies or respiratory issues for sensitive individuals. Regular cleaning and preventative measures contribute to a healthier laundry environment and extend the lifespan of the washing machine’s rubber components. Locating an optimal site for vending equipment involves a multifaceted process of assessing potential locations based on factors like foot traffic, demographics, competition, and necessary permits. For example, a vending machine offering snacks and beverages might be well-suited for a busy office building, while a machine specializing in healthy options could thrive in a fitness center. The suitability of a particular site depends heavily on aligning the offered products with the needs and desires of the expected customer base.

Successful placement directly influences sales volume and profitability. Careful site selection minimizes risk and maximizes return on investment. Historically, vending machine placement relied heavily on observational data and intuition. Modern approaches leverage data analytics, market research, and sophisticated location analysis tools to identify high-potential areas with greater precision. This evolution allows vendors to target specific demographics and optimize product offerings for maximum impact.

Maintaining a smoke machine involves regularly removing residue buildup from its internal components and exterior surfaces. This process typically includes flushing the fluid system with a specialized cleaning solution and physically wiping down the machine’s housing.

Regular maintenance ensures optimal performance and prolongs the lifespan of the device. A clean machine produces consistent, high-quality fog effects, free from blockages or sputtering. Furthermore, it minimizes the risk of malfunctions and potential damage caused by accumulated residue. Neglecting cleaning can lead to costly repairs or even necessitate premature replacement.

Washing a leather jacket in a conventional washing machine is generally not recommended. Leather is a natural material that can shrink, stiffen, or become damaged by the harsh agitation and detergents used in a typical machine wash cycle. The intense tumbling, combined with excessive moisture, can strip the leather of its natural oils, leading to cracking and discoloration. Therefore, alternative cleaning methods are typically advised for maintaining the quality and longevity of a leather garment.

Preserving the suppleness and appearance of leather jackets requires careful cleaning. Proper care helps retain the garment’s value and extends its lifespan. Replacing a malfunctioning water inlet valve on a washing machine involves shutting off the water supply, disconnecting the appliance, accessing the valve (typically located at the rear), detaching the hoses and wiring, installing the new valve, and reconnecting everything. This procedure addresses issues like leaks, inadequate water fill, or no water entering the machine.

A functional water inlet valve is essential for proper washing machine operation. It regulates the flow of both hot and cold water into the appliance, ensuring the correct temperature and volume for each wash cycle. Addressing a faulty valve promptly prevents water damage, improves cleaning effectiveness, and extends the lifespan of the washing machine. Historically, these valves have evolved from simple mechanical components to more sophisticated electronically controlled systems, offering greater precision and reliability.

Blood pressure monitor accuracy is crucial for effective hypertension management. Maintaining accuracy involves periodic checks against a known accurate standard, typically performed by trained technicians using specialized equipment. This process verifies that the device’s readings align with established standards, ensuring reliable blood pressure measurements. For example, a technician might use a mercury sphygmomanometer, considered a gold standard, to compare readings with the digital monitor being tested. Discrepancies beyond acceptable tolerances require adjustment or repair.

Reliable blood pressure readings are essential for both diagnosis and ongoing management of hypertension. Inaccurate measurements can lead to misdiagnosis, inappropriate treatment, and potential health risks. Historically, mercury sphygmomanometers served as the primary method for accurate blood pressure measurement. Advances in technology have led to the development of automated and digital devices, offering convenience and portability. However, these devices require regular verification to maintain accuracy over time, protecting patients from the potentially serious consequences of inaccurate readings.

Cleaning an espresso machine using a specialized cleaning agent and forcing water backward through the system removes coffee residue and oils buildup. This process typically involves using a blind filter, a small, solid disc that replaces the portafilter and prevents water from escaping. The detergent is added to the blind filter, and the machine is activated in short bursts, pushing the solution through the brewing group and clearing out internal pathways.

Regular cleaning contributes significantly to the longevity and consistent performance of espresso machines. By removing built-up coffee oils and grounds, the process prevents bitter flavors in the espresso and protects internal components from clogging and damage. This preventative maintenance avoids costly repairs and ensures a consistently high-quality beverage. Historically, backflushing has become a standard practice with the rise of pump-driven espresso machines and the recognition of the impact of residue on flavor and machine performance.

Proper machine tuning involves manipulating several components to achieve optimal performance for various tattooing styles. This includes adjusting the needle depth, modifying the give and throw of the machine, and ensuring appropriate voltage regulation. For example, lining requires a shallow needle depth and a fast, responsive machine, while shading necessitates a deeper depth and a smoother, slower delivery. Understanding these adjustments allows artists to create precise lines, smooth shading, and vibrant color saturation.

Accurate machine calibration is critical for both the artist and the client. It allows for greater control, resulting in cleaner lines, consistent color packing, and reduced trauma to the skin. This precision minimizes healing time and contributes to a higher quality finished tattoo. Historically, artists relied heavily on mentorship and hands-on experience to master these techniques. However, access to information has broadened considerably, allowing aspiring artists to learn these crucial skills more readily.

The quantity of oil required for a popcorn machine depends on several factors, including the machine’s capacity, the type of popcorn kernel used (butterfly/snowflake vs. mushroom), and the manufacturer’s recommendations. Typically, a ratio of oil to kernels is specified for optimal popping. For example, a common ratio might be one tablespoon of oil for every half cup of kernels, but this can vary. Using too little oil can lead to burning, while excessive oil can result in soggy popcorn.

Correct oil measurement is essential for producing high-quality popcorn. Proper oil usage ensures even heating and popping, maximizing yield while minimizing unpopped kernels. Historically, coconut oil was a popular choice due to its flavor profile and high smoke point. Today, oils specifically designed for popcorn production are available, often offering enhanced flavor and stability at high temperatures. Choosing the right oil and using the correct amount contributes significantly to the taste and texture of the final product.

The quantity of oil necessary for optimal popcorn popping depends on several factors, including the machine’s capacity, the type of popcorn kernels used, and the heating method. Typically, a home popcorn machine requires between two and four tablespoons of oil per batch. Commercial machines, with larger capacities, may require significantly more. Using coconut oil, canola oil, or specialized popcorn oil delivers desirable flavor and popping performance.

Using the correct oil quantity ensures each kernel pops fully without burning or leaving unpopped kernels, maximizing yield and flavor. Too little oil can lead to scorching, while excessive oil can result in soggy popcorn. Historically, various fats and oils have been employed for popcorn preparation, with modern methods often favoring those with higher smoke points and desirable flavor profiles.
